How does the table’s design account for varying levels of user seating arrangements?

Modern table design has evolved significantly to address the complex needs of varying user seating arrangements in contemporary work and learning environments. The fundamental approach lies in creating adaptable surfaces that respond to different user heights, group configurations, and activity requirements.

Height adjustability represents one of the most crucial design elements, with electric, manual, and pneumatic mechanisms allowing tables to accommodate everything from standard office chairs to standing positions and specialized seating. This flexibility ensures proper ergonomic alignment for users of different statures and preferences, reducing physical strain during extended use.

Table shapes and dimensions play an equally important role in seating accommodation. Rectangular tables often serve traditional arrangements with clear hierarchical positioning, while circular and oval designs foster equality among participants by eliminating "head of table" positions. Modular table systems with connectable components enable organizations to create custom configurations ranging from individual workstations to large collaborative setups, seamlessly adapting to group sizes and interaction patterns.

The integration of technology further enhances seating arrangement flexibility. Tables with centralized power modules and cable management systems allow users to occupy any position without sacrificing access to electrical outlets or data ports. This technological democratization eliminates "premium seating" scenarios where only certain positions offer convenient power access.

Edge profiles and leg placements significantly impact how users interact with tables. Cantilevered designs and centrally supported bases maximize legroom and facilitate easy repositioning of chairs, while waterfall edges reduce pressure on forearms during extended use. These subtle design choices directly influence how comfortably people can sit at various positions around the table.

Material selection also contributes to seating accommodation. Lightweight yet durable surfaces enable easy reconfiguration, while appropriate thickness and sound-dampening properties create acoustically comfortable environments regardless of seating density.

Modern table design essentially transforms static furniture into dynamic tools that actively support how people choose to sit and interact. By considering adjustability, configuration options, technological integration, and ergonomic details, designers create tables that don't just accommodate users but actively enhance their experience through thoughtful accommodation of diverse seating needs.
